ROLE IMPACT
Support a high-volume family medicine practice serving approximately 80 patients per day. This front-office, non-clinical role helps create an efficient patient experience through accurate check-in and check-out, responsive phone support, appointment scheduling, and coordination with the clinical team. Success requires strong patient service, multitasking, and the flexibility to rotate across front-office functions in a fast-moving healthcare environment.
KEY RESPONSIBILITIES
• Greet patients and manage check-in and check-out, registration, demographic updates, and front-desk documentation
• Answer and route incoming calls, schedule and confirm appointments, and rotate phone responsibilities with the front-office team
• Collect and update patient information while maintaining accurate and organized records; the practice system handles the insurance verification component
• Coordinate patient flow with clinical staff in a busy family medicine practice with on-site X-ray and laboratory capabilities
• Maintain a professional, organized reception area while providing responsive patient service throughout the day
